I agree with the previous poster. DO NOT call 911 for a stolen phone if there is a non emergency line in your county. You can get into some serious trouble for abusing the 911 line. Generally speaking, if you have the receipt, you can take it to the pd and have a complaint number generated for you to take to the phone company if you are using insurance to replace it. Unless, of course, it was taken during the commission of another crime, you were assaulted and it was stolen, mugging, etc, but even in that case, it didn't just happen and you still should not call 911 for it.
 
Just call the phone provider to cancel the phone. The police don't want to bother likely, unless there is violence involved, and/or strong evidence to lead them to the perpetrator.
